인프런 커뮤니티 질문&답변

zoown13님의 프로필 이미지
zoown13

작성한 질문수

실전! 스프링 부트와 JPA 활용1 - 웹 애플리케이션 개발

상품 기능 테스트하는 코드를 작성해보았는데 올바르게 작성했는지 궁금합니다.

작성

·

160

0

안녕하세요,  스프링 부트 강의를 듣고있는 학생입니다. 다름아니라 상품 기능 테스트 부분은 회원 테스트와 비슷하다고 하셔서 제가 임의로 테스트 코드를 짜보았는데 올바르게 작성했는지가 궁금해서 질문드립니다. 아무래도 처음 배우다보니 확실히 알고싶어서 질문드립니다.

아래 코드는 상품 기능 중에 addStock 메소드를 테스트하기 위해 작성한 코드입니다.

assertEquals 를 통해  재고를 2로 설정 후 1을 추가, 즉, 2+1=3 이 제대로 작동하는지 확인하는 코드입니다.

답변 2

1

zoown13님의 프로필 이미지
zoown13
질문자

옙 빠른 답변 감사합니다.

1

김영한님의 프로필 이미지
김영한
지식공유자

안녕하세요. zoown13님

잘 작성하셨습니다.

이 경우에는 스프링이 없어도 테스트가 가능하겠네요^^

itemRepository, itemService가 없어도 될 것 같습니다.

감사합니다.

zoown13님의 프로필 이미지
zoown13

작성한 질문수

질문하기